There’s more good news for Arklow this morning.
Following it’s recent decision to give the go ahead for a new Data complex for the town, An Bord Pleanala has upheld planning permission for the new Arklow Waste Water Treatment Plant.
The decision will allow for the construction of a Waste Water treatment plant, which it's believed will take around two years to complete., opening up the opportunity for a huge growth potential for Arklow.
Welcoming the news, Wicklow T.D. Pat Casey said this has been a long time coming and the ball is now in Irish Water's court to ensure the facility is up and running as soon as possible.
